Mybatis框架
道法—自然
不积跬步,无以至千里;不积小流,无以成江海。——荀子
展开
-
mybatis听课笔记(mybatis的动态代理,查询操作)
原创 2018-10-25 08:58:17 · 218 阅读 · 0 评论 -
mybatis的听课笔记(resultMap的多表联合查询)
原创 2018-10-27 00:27:19 · 460 阅读 · 0 评论 -
mybatis听课笔记(mybatis中的注解)
迭代升级,解耦性。注解和可以和XML混用。原创 2018-10-27 00:27:54 · 133 阅读 · 0 评论 -
mybatis听课笔记(mybatis.xml的配置)
<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E configuration PUBLIC "-//mybatis.org//DTD Config 3.0//EN" "http://mybatis.org/dtd/mybatis-3-config.dtd"><configuration>原创 2018-10-24 08:11:04 · 107 阅读 · 0 评论 -
mybatis听课笔记(log4j的配置)
原创 2018-10-24 08:16:01 · 103 阅读 · 0 评论 -
mybatis听课笔记(根据单个条件查询)
0是占位符,也是赋值语句。原创 2018-10-24 08:39:50 · 561 阅读 · 0 评论 -
mybatis听课笔记(根据多个条件查询)
list不常用,用的最多的是map实例化对象。 <?xml version="1.0" encoding="UTF-8"?><!DOCTYPE mapper P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" "http://mybatis.org/dtd/mybatis-3-mapper.dtd">原创 2018-10-24 08:51:39 · 719 阅读 · 0 评论 -
mybatis听课笔记(修改)
package com.bjsxt.servlet;import java.io.IOException;import java.io.InputStream;import java.util.HashMap;import java.util.List;import org.apache.ibatis.io.Resources;import org.apache.ibatis.s...原创 2018-10-24 08:54:12 · 116 阅读 · 1 评论 -
mybatis听课笔记(mybatis的缓存)
mybatis的缓存:缓存就是不走数据库,直接去拿的。 要关闭缓存原创 2018-10-27 00:28:04 · 192 阅读 · 0 评论 -
mybatis听课笔记(mybatis的责任链)
Mybatis的责任链:ThreadLocal的作用域是同一个线程。 线程一中的数据,在线程二中是取不到的,因为id不相同。例子是储物柜,每个人只能有一个id多线程就是卖火车票类进内存即完成factory的对象 静态代码块,需要在代码块的外边申明静态变量 也就是每个线程单独执行这句话:主要线程一放了,线程一在任意一个位置都可以拿,而线程二是拿不...原创 2018-10-27 00:28:12 · 958 阅读 · 1 评论 -
mybatis听课笔记(完成单表的查询)
原创 2018-10-24 12:50:10 · 140 阅读 · 0 评论 -
mybatis听课笔记(mybatis完成单表的增加)
下面这个只是做了一个占位下面这个才是真正的赋值原创 2018-10-24 13:03:29 · 144 阅读 · 0 评论 -
mybatis听课笔记(mybatis完成单表的删除)
原创 2018-10-25 08:31:37 · 104 阅读 · 0 评论 -
银行转账案例
原创 2018-10-25 08:32:24 · 1041 阅读 · 1 评论 -
mybatis听课笔记(银行转账案例)
原创 2018-10-25 08:32:35 · 699 阅读 · 1 评论 -
mybatis听课笔记(练习,后半部分)
不同的传参,相同的保留。 分页查询:查询 获取后台发过来的数据,进行解析和处理。原创 2018-11-01 08:41:50 · 133 阅读 · 1 评论 -
mybatis听课笔记(resultMap N+1方式多表操作数据库)
以上是查询一对多的:以下是查询多对一的: 而要用collection 一对一使用的是association一对多使用的是collection 用的更多的是联合查询 ...原创 2018-10-26 08:54:57 · 297 阅读 · 0 评论 -
mybatis听课笔记(mybatis.xml的其他配置:包括数据库地址,日志,别名,mapper的配置,property属性的配置)
默认就是开启log4j的原创 2018-10-24 00:16:36 · 217 阅读 · 0 评论 -
mybatis听课笔记(mybatis.xml的配置)
使用数据库连接技术,需要等待。原创 2018-10-24 00:01:29 · 103 阅读 · 0 评论 -
mybatis听课笔记(基于sql动态代理方式完成单表有参数的增删改查)
当接口是对象的时候,直接用对象的属性名。 其实底层就是一个map原创 2018-10-25 13:41:50 · 147 阅读 · 0 评论 -
mybatis听课笔记
原创 2018-10-23 09:22:24 · 171 阅读 · 0 评论 -
Springboot项目修改html后不需要重启---springboot项目的热部署
一、spring-boot-devtools 在pom中直接引入依赖<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</artifactId> <...原创 2018-10-23 14:55:32 · 11433 阅读 · 6 评论 -
mybatis听课笔记(mybatis的sql动态拼接,where,if等)
获取sqlsession对象 if条件语句的动态拼接 这个里边必须写1==1为了避免忘记写1=1where标签 where会自动生成where关键字并去除第一个and 或者or ...原创 2018-10-26 00:13:21 · 2672 阅读 · 0 评论 -
mybatis听课笔记( choose,when,other等条件限制的查询)
原创 2018-10-26 00:13:34 · 1841 阅读 · 0 评论 -
mybatis听课笔记(更新用户信息)
使用技巧来操作使用set关键字原创 2018-10-26 00:13:47 · 155 阅读 · 0 评论 -
mybatis听课笔记(trim标签)
原创 2018-10-26 00:13:59 · 103 阅读 · 0 评论 -
mybatis听课笔记(foreach循环标签)
in里边的个数不确定,使用佛reach 使用场景是页面上的表格原创 2018-10-26 00:14:25 · 1071 阅读 · 0 评论 -
mybatis听课笔记(bind标签,模糊查询)
bind标签:原创 2018-10-26 00:14:36 · 586 阅读 · 0 评论 -
mybatis听课笔记(动态查询用户信息练习)
创建(部署)项目创建包导jar包Ajax和非Ajax的区别:Ajax没有form 默认给的就是非空字符串 分页:原创 2018-10-26 00:14:50 · 177 阅读 · 0 评论 -
mybatis听课笔记(一对多关系查询,业务装配)
一对多关系查询:sql动态拼接:trim,where,if,choose,bind 一对一,一对多,多对多 学生的写一个mapper .xml老师的也写一个mapper .xml 装配发生在业务层,所以叫业务装配。 ...原创 2018-10-26 00:15:04 · 206 阅读 · 0 评论 -
mybatis听课笔记(业务装配与自动注入)
resulttype是申明查询结果应该赋值给哪一个实例化对象应该按照什么样的规则注入到实例化对象中如果查询到的字段名和实体类的属性名不一致,则按照result type来命名。或者其他的走自动注入,其他的手动注入,自动注入和手动注入可以混用...原创 2018-10-26 00:15:18 · 383 阅读 · 0 评论 -
mybatis听课笔记(二)
原创 2018-10-23 22:46:11 · 102 阅读 · 0 评论 -
mybatis听课笔记(三) 完整项目花卉信息
原创 2018-10-23 23:10:54 · 155 阅读 · 0 评论 -
mybatis听课笔记(servlet3.0的配置)
监听器的配置:过滤器的配置:原创 2018-10-23 23:31:03 · 166 阅读 · 0 评论 -
文件上传的XML文件
<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E mapper P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" "http://mybatis.org/dtd/mybatis-3-mapper.dtd"><mapper namespace="com.boot原创 2018-11-03 00:02:08 · 1743 阅读 · 1 评论